如何下载PDM系统源代码?

随着信息化时代的到来,PDM(Product Data Management,产品数据管理)系统在企业中的应用越来越广泛。PDM系统可以有效地管理企业中的产品数据,提高数据共享和协同效率,降低成本。然而,由于PDM系统的核心代码通常由厂商保密,用户很难获取到PDM系统的源代码。本文将为您介绍如何下载PDM系统源代码的方法。

一、了解PDM系统源代码的重要性

  1. 自主研发:获取PDM系统源代码可以帮助企业根据自身需求进行二次开发,提高系统的适应性和扩展性。

  2. 降低成本:通过获取源代码,企业可以避免购买商业PDM系统的费用,降低成本。

  3. 提高竞争力:掌握PDM系统源代码,有助于企业提高在市场竞争中的地位。

二、下载PDM系统源代码的方法

  1. 购买PDM系统源代码

(1)联系PDM系统厂商:首先,您可以尝试联系PDM系统厂商,了解是否提供源代码购买服务。如果厂商提供源代码购买服务,您可以根据需求选择合适的版本和价格。

(2)签订合同:在购买源代码前,与厂商签订合同,明确双方的权利和义务。


  1. 源代码泄露

(1)关注开源社区:开源社区中可能存在PDM系统源代码泄露的情况。您可以关注一些知名的开源社区,如GitHub、GitLab等,搜索相关PDM系统项目。

(2)下载源代码:在确认源代码安全可靠后,下载PDM系统源代码。


  1. 自行逆向工程

(1)获取PDM系统安装包:首先,您需要获取PDM系统的安装包。

(2)逆向工程:使用逆向工程工具,如IDA Pro、OllyDbg等,对PDM系统进行逆向分析,提取核心代码。

(3)编译源代码:将提取的核心代码进行编译,生成可执行文件。


  1. 合作开发

(1)寻找合作伙伴:寻找熟悉PDM系统源代码的开发团队或个人,共同开发PDM系统。

(2)签订合作协议:与合作伙伴签订合作协议,明确双方的权利和义务。

(3)共享源代码:在合作过程中,共享PDM系统源代码,共同开发。

三、注意事项

  1. 法律风险:在下载或获取PDM系统源代码时,务必确保不侵犯他人的知识产权,避免法律风险。

  2. 技术难度:逆向工程和合作开发PDM系统源代码需要较高的技术能力,请确保具备相关技能。

  3. 安全性:下载或获取PDM系统源代码时,要确保来源可靠,避免下载恶意软件。

  4. 维护成本:获取PDM系统源代码后,企业需要投入人力、物力进行维护和升级。

总之,下载PDM系统源代码有助于企业提高系统适应性和降低成本。然而,在下载或获取源代码的过程中,企业需要关注法律风险、技术难度、安全性和维护成本等问题。希望本文能为您提供一定的参考和帮助。

猜你喜欢:MES软件